1. Bellagio Casino & Fountain Show

Bellagio Casino & Fountain Show

Image Source

The Bellagio is a high-end, spectacular resort with a number of gems hidden away in its corridors. You can visit the Gallery of Fine Arts, Botanical Gardens, as well as the Conservatory here. The place houses several restaurants as well as a spa and salon, apart from the legendary Bellagio casino which is one of the biggest Las Vegas tourist attractions.

Apart from all this, the beautiful fountain here is another famous feature. Every fifteen or so minutes, the fountain goes off with a beautiful showcase of water along with a music set. This fountain show is a must if you are looking for free things to see in Las Vegas.

Location: 3600 S Las Vegas Blvd, Las Vegas

2. High Roller Ferris Wheel

High Roller Ferris Wheel

Image Source

What better to do than ride a Ferris wheel in Sin City? Located at the Linq Promenade, this wheel is the icon of the city. Standing at 550 feet high, this observation wheel gives a full panoramic view of the city as well as its most famous destination, the Strip. One full rotation will take about 30 minutes. The capsules or cabins usually have around thirty to forty people, each. Riding the wheel at night offers an even more spectacular view of Las Vegas in its glory.

Location: 3545 S Las Vegas Blvd, Las Vegas
Timings: 11:30 AM – 2:00 AM
Entry fee: INR 2000 (For Day), INR 3000 (For Night)

3. Hoover Dam

Hoover Dam

Image Source

This magnificent dam Built on the Colorado River houses Lake Mead, which is the largest water reservoir in the country. Moreover, the dam, built in 1935, provides electricity to three different states – Nevada, California, and Arizona. You should also add Grand Canyon and Hoover Dam in your list of places to visit in the USA. Both these attractions can be covered in a day-trip. You can even take a helicopter ride to get aerial views of the city along with those of the beautiful Grand Canyon.

Location: Nevada, USA
Timings: 9:00 AM – 5:00 PM

4. Stratosphere

Stratosphere Las Vegas

Image Source

Another entry on places of interest in Las Vegas is the beautiful and breathtaking Stratosphere Tower. At a height of almost 1150 feet, the tower offers a number of good reasons to drop by. You can enjoy some thrill rides on the top like SkyJump, Insanity and Big Shot. And if you are someone who does not enjoy the adrenaline rush, the outdoor deck offers some great views of the city, making it one of the best places in Las Vegas.

Location: 2000 S Las Vegas Blvd, Las Vegas

5. The Mob Museum

The Mob Museum.jpg

Image Source

Officially called the National Museum of Organized Crime and Law Enforcement, this place will remind you of the Wild-Wild-West you have seen in Hollywood movies. The museum and its exhibits are an attempt to document the story of the Mob in the USA through technology, with exhibits portraying individuals, fashion trends and even the cultural events of the time. The video clips and other portrayal is quite interactive, making it a must on all the Las Vegas sightseeing tours.

Location: 300 Stewart Ave, Las Vegas
Timings: 9:00 AM – 9:00 PM
Entry fee: INR 2000

6. Paris, Las Vegas

Paris, Las Vegas

Image Source

What can be better than covering two cities in one day? The Paris, Las Vegas, gives you the chance to do just that. Located outside the resort is the model of Eiffel Tower which makes into most of the Las Vegas pictures. You will also find a ‘Paris Opera House’ along with the romantic Eiffel Tower restaurant in the building. Take the lift to the forty-sixth floor and enjoy the views of the city just like you would have on the Eiffel Tower itself. If you are going with your partner, it is hands down one of the best places to visit in Las Vegas.

Location: 3655 S Las Vegas Blvd, Las Vegas
Timings: 10:00 AM – 1:00 AM
Entry fee: INR 1200 (For Day), INR 1600 (For Night)

7. The Strip

The Strip

Image Source

The Strip is the answer if you don’t know where to go in Las Vegas, USA. This almost 3-kilometer long section runs through the middle of Sin City and is lined with luxury resorts, theme places, grand restaurants, and jubilant casinos. It is even better to visit the Strip at night as the whole city is then illuminated with yellow lights and neon signs, making it an enthralling experience. Frankly, all the best places to see in Las Vegas are either around or near the Strip.

Location: Sahara Avenue to Russell Road, Las Vegas

8.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area

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area

Image Source

There a number of guided tours available for Red Rock Canyon, which will take you far away from the lights and noise of the city. Enjoy the serene 25-kilometer long drive to the desert in the middle of nowhere. Take a hike here or simply enjoy the Mojave desert with its red hills. Options are limitless, which makes Red Rock a star feature in Las Vegas tourism scene.

Location: 1000 Scenic Loop Dr, Las Vegas
Timings: 6:00 AM – 8:00 PM
Entry fee: INR 500

9. The Neon Museum

The Neon Museum

Image Source

This museum is a homage to the city itself – Las Vegas has always been the home to some of the brightest neon signs on the side of the streets. The museum basically is an effort to store, showcase, and refurbish these signs which have been in use for years. The guides tell the history of the signs displayed. Some of these pieces are restored and some are in their original condition, as the whole pieces could not be recovered.

Location: 770 N Las Vegas Blvd, Las Vegas
Timings: 9:30 AM – 11:00 PM (weekdays), 9:30 AM – 12:00 AM (weekend)

10. MGM Grand & CSI

MGM Grand & CSI

Image Source

One of the best Las Vegas attractions for adults, MGM Grand offers CSI: The Experience. You can thus test out your detective skills by participating in this simulated version of the popular TV series. The Grand restaurant along the beautiful pool in this resort is a sight for sore eyes.

Location: 3799 S Las Vegas Blvd, Las Vegas
Timings: 9:00 AM – 9:00 PM
